Kevin Roy Odds to Win and Stats for The 2026 The CJ Cup Byron Nelson

Data Skrive

Kevin Roy earned a third-place finish in his last action in the 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ic at The Dunes Golf and Beach Club on May 7-10, and heads into the 2026 The CJ Cup Byron Nelson at TPC Craig Ranch with +11500 odds to win. Kevin Roy’s recent tournaments

Date Tournament Finish Score Shots Behind Leader Earnings
May 7-10 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ic 3 68-66-65-69 (-16) 2 $236,000
April 2-5 Valero Texas Open 30 67-68-74-72 (-7) 10 $60,025
March 26-29 Texas Children’s Houston Open 65 67-71-73-69 (E) 21 $21,087
March 19-22 Valspar Championship 73 72-69-73-74 (+4) 15 $18,109
March 12-15 The Players Championship 59 75-71-71-75 (+4) 17 $56,250

Kevin Roy’s recent performance

  • Roy has made the cut seven times in a row and will look to continue his streak this week.
  • Roy has finished with a score lower than the tournament average in two of his last five events, including one finish within three strokes of the leader.
  • He has an average score of -3 across his last five events.
  • Roy has finished in the top five once over his last five tournaments.
  • Roy has finshed under par nine times, completed his day without a bogey once and finished nine rounds with a better-than-average score over his last 16 rounds played.
  • He has carded the best score of the day in one of his last 16 rounds, while scoring among the top five in two rounds and the top 10 four times.

Kevin Roy’s Last Time Out

  • Roy shot better on par 3s than most players his last time out, carding a birdie or better on four of the 16 par-3 holes at the 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ic (the other participants averaged 1.7).
  • On the 16 par-3 holes at the 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ic, Roy carded two bogeys or worse, equal to the field average.
  • Roy’s eight birdies or better on par-4 holes at the 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ic were more than the field average (6.2).
  • At that last outing, Roy’s performance on the 44 par-4 holes included a bogey or worse four times (compared to the field’s worse average of 6.0).
  • Roy finished the 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ic registering a birdie or better on 11 par-5 holes, compared to the field average of 4.4 on the 12 par-5 holes.
  • Even though the field at the ONEFlight Myrtle Beach Classic averaged 0.6 bogeys or worse on the 12 par-5 holes, Roy finished without one.
